2024 Lawn aeration devices - Aug 4, 2023 · A lawn aerator is a piece of lawn equipment designed to poke holes in grass so vital nutrients can reach the root system. Without aeration, the dirt underneath grass can be compounded, preventing air, water and fertilizer from reaching soil.

 
 Whether you're using a core aerator or a spike aerator, go completely over the lawn in one direction and then go back over it in a perpendicular direction. Spike aerators will punch holes in the lawn as you go, while core aerators will remove plugs of grass and soil. It's fine to leave the plugs on the lawn to decompose. . Lawn aeration devices

Aerovating - This process uses a machine with vibrating tines which penetrate the soil ... The cost of lawn aeration is about $140 per 10,000 square feet of yard. Depending on the aeration method used and the size of your lawn, you could spend as low as $75 or as much as $400 for extra services. Spike aeration is generally the least expensive, ranging from $40 to $250 for 10,000 square feet. Frequent lawn traffic, heavy decor or equipment, and even extreme weather like drought ...Feb 4, 2020 · One way to check this is to remove part of the lawn with a shovel and dig four inches down. If your thatch layer is deeper than ½ an inch aeration is a good idea. Finally an important reason to aerate, is if you personally established your lawn by sod. Lawns that were grown from sod means there is soil layering. Mar 1, 2023 ... Core aerators pull plugs about ½- to ¾-inch in diameter, 2 to 4 inches deep, and about 2 to 6 inches apart. This lawn aerator has a 1500 W motor, five adjustable heights and a 10 m power cable.A manual spike aerator or aerator shoe is a very affordable way to aerate a lawn. Such devices can often be purchased for between $30 and $50. Liquid aerator is another affordable option, but this enzymatic spray may not work as well as actual, physical aeration for helping ease compacted soil and may take several applications.Dethatchers, scarifiers, and aerators are the most popular options for this task. Towable core aerator —If you have a larger area to aerate and plan to do it regularly, buying a core aerator that can be towed behind a riding mower may make sense. You can buy a towable aerator for about $200. Walk-behind aerator —You can rent an aerator for about $60 for four hours or $90 for an entire day.From hydraulic or gas augers to chippers and stumpers, United Rentals has the most comprehensive selection of landscape equipment in the world. The 48 plugging spoons are heat-treated for …You can aerate a lawn manually using a fork. Spike the lawn deeply with the fork at intervals of around 12in (30cm), and then move it backwards and forwards to enlarge the holes. This is a method that’s suitable for small areas, but it’s really better to use a purpose-made tool. ‘Manual options include rollers with spikes on, and even a .... Player search ffxiv
